草庐IT

right-align

全部标签

css - 将外部 div 居中, 'text-align:center' 未按预期工作

我在一个div中有一段内容,目前它位于左侧居中。Fiddle.我尝试添加一个容器div,例如:[content]但运气不好。也试过这个:[content]内容仍然左对齐。这可行,但我想找到使用CSS执行此操作的正确方法:[content]感谢协助。我很想用表格来做这件事,但我需要改掉旧习惯! 最佳答案 如果您尝试让外部div相对于其父级(body)居中,您应该将其横向边距设置为auto:bodydiv{margin:auto;}如你所见here 关于css-将外部div居中,'text-

jquery - 给一个 "text-align: center"的 div 一个 "text-align: left"仅用于包装内容

使用CSS或JQuery(首选CSS),是否可以采用一个div(宽度为100%),将其内容居中,并将任何换行的内容对齐到左侧?想象一下以您的浏览器为中心的一组图标。如果您减小浏览器的宽度,而不是在第二行的中心显示环绕图标,我希望它们左对齐。我在发帖前尝试在这里搜索,但找不到与我的问题完全匹配的内容。更新:@ExplosionPills解决了它,但这里有一个更新的JSFiddle,它通过将word-wrap:pre-wrap;添加到外部div来解决IE和Chrome以外的浏览器>:http://jsfiddle.net/etY4r/2/ 最佳答案

html - 设置中心位置的 margin-left 和 margin-right

我想将中心设置为.user-menu位置,但我下面的代码不起作用。我该如何解决这个问题?HTMLتاریخچهخریدحسابکاربریCSS*{margin:0px;padding:0px;font-family:Tahoma;}.centered{margin-left:auto;margin-right:auto;}.menu-items{float:left;height:90px;margin-left:10px;margin-right:10px;}.profile{width:72px;height:72px;padding-left:10px;padding-righ

css - float :right divs appear on next line in IE only

好的,所以在开始编写Web应用程序代码之前,我正在制作我的UI原型(prototype)。我在Firefox中工作时完成了大部分设计,(当然)当我在IE中测试它时,存在很多渲染问题。其中一个问题是,如果我有一个包含一些文本的div和另一个设置为float:right的div,则嵌套的div会显示在下一行,在其父div下方。这是最简单形式的问题标记...TextRight我在互联网上搜索解决方案,我发现唯一可行的相关解决方案使它在IE中工作是将floatdiv放在其父级的开头,如下所示...RightText实际上,嵌套的div有一个类,我的CSS是float的那个类。但是,如果我最终制

vertical-alignment - CSS 垂直对齐和基线位置

我是CSS的新手,最近阅读了规范,但在理解垂直对齐属性方面遇到了一些问题。上面的代码创建了3个div,每个包含3个空的内联框(spans):在第一个div中,一切似乎都很好。所有3个跨度都与线框的基线对齐。在第二个div中,在我将第三个跨度的vertical-align属性设置为top后,前两个跨度向上移动。我从这里迷路了,我不明白为什么他们会根据什么规则被提升。第三个div更适合我。我将第一个跨度的vertical-align属性设置为bottom,它导致第二个跨度比第三个跨度移动略低(放大到足够大时会注意到这一点)。我在规范中找到的内容如下所述,但是多种解决方案到底是什么?谁能对此

javascript - Bootstrap 3 Navbar Collapse menu at Left for left and right navbar items

我有一个带有左侧导航项和右侧导航项的Bootstrap3导航栏(如下所示)。折叠时,我希望导航栏切换(又名“汉堡菜单”)及其元素都左对齐。到目前为止我的代码:LeftLeftRightRight左侧导航栏切换的CSS是:@media(max-width:767px){.custom-navbar.navbar-right{float:right;padding-right:15px;}.custom-navbar.nav.navbar-nav.navbar-rightli{float:left;}.custom-navbar.nav.navbar-nav.navbar-rightli>

html - Bootstrap 4 float-right inside .row

我是Bootstrap4的新手,似乎无法在一行内工作的coldiv上正确float。这是我的代码:FivegridtiersHi奇怪的是,如果没有行作为父div,它也能正常工作,但我想使用行。我错过了什么吗?谢谢:) 最佳答案 row是bootstrap-4中的flex容器,要对齐flex-container中的内容,您需要使用ml-auto和mr-auto。例子如下:HellofromleftHellofromright这是官方文档链接和示例:https://getbootstrap.com/docs/4.0/utilities/

html - 纯 CSS 选择菜单/下拉菜单 : How to make custom right arrow?

我根据此处的解决方案使用自定义选择/下拉菜单:https://stackoverflow.com/a/10190884/1318135这个功能很好,只是右边的“箭头”看起来不太好。我希望它更宽一些,外观类似于本网站上的向上/向下投票箭头(向左看)。已尝试以下操作,打开使用这些或其他选项中的任何一个的解决方案:-将图像集成到HTML中(无法使其显示在前景v.下拉列表中)-为字符定位一个带有更宽箭头的字体(找不到)-在CSS中设置背景图像属性(改为显示默认的向下箭头)http://jsfiddle.net/XxkSC/553/HTML:SushiBluecheesewithcrackers

html - 您可以将图像分配给 border-right 吗?

我正在用html和css制作一个导航菜单,但我希望每个导航项的右边框是一个图像。我试过了border-right:url(image.jpg);但这没有用。我该怎么做? 最佳答案 您可以使用背景图像,然后将背景图像放置在每个元素的右侧。通常这会出现在a标签或li上。例如:#primaryNava:link{background-image:url('image.jpg');background-position:right;background-repeat:no-repeat;display:block;/*makethelink

css - Bootstrap 中不能出现 "pull-right"图标字形

我想在下拉菜单中拉出右图标字形,如下所示Dropdown2-levelDropdownActionAnotheractionSomethingelsehereAnotheractionOnemoreseparatedlink但是当我在FireFox(Chrome和IE都可以)上运行这段代码时,“icon-arrow-right”和“2-levelDropdown”不是同一行。我该如何解决?FullcodeonJSFIDDLE 最佳答案 2-levelDropdownjsfiddle 关于